Trail Running at Smith Ranch
The Tierra Redonda Mountain Trail Run takes place at Smith Ranch in Bradley, California. This event is held on a private cattle ranch and features a 4 mile loop course. The route consists of 100% dirt paths, utilizing a mix of ranch roads and single track trails. Each loop includes approximately 202 feet of elevation gain.
Participants can choose from several distance options and time-based events:
- 12km consisting of two loops.
- 25km consisting of four loops.
- 24 Hour run involving multiple loops.
- 48 Hour run involving multiple loops.
The course offers views of the surrounding landscape and moderate climbs. Runners have access to well-stocked aid stations, with the main aid station and basecamp located at the end of every 4 mile loop.
Event Experience and Amenities
The gathering is family-friendly and permits dogs on a leash. All finishers receive awards, while the top male and female performers in each distance are presented with handcrafted trophies. The staging area is located at the Smith Ranch Hay Barn, where all races start and finish.
Primitive overnight camping is available on-site for vehicles, motorhomes, RVs, and tents. There are no hookups or amenities provided for campers.
